Anyway, this is open source software, you can get the full revision
history for every file in the repository. It's right there on the
website[1].

Of course, you ask "all the different versions of SSH" and I assume
you mean different versions of OpenSSH. There are others, many based
on OpenSSH (with varying levels of differentiation from the original).
In fact, your employer has its own fork of OpenSSH included in its
UNIX distribution, AIX[2].
